MediaTek’s new processor to arrive on January 20

MediaTek introduced its Dimensity processors last year. The company is planning to expand its portfolio with the launch of new processors under the series.
MediaTek has dropped a new teaser for its upcoming Dimensity processor on microblogging site Weibo.
The post reads, “On January 20, the new products of the Dimensity series will meet with you. Brand new products, superior technology, and upgraded experience”. (roughly translated from Chinese using Google translate)
The post does not reveal anything else about the upcoming products.
However, we can expect to see a processor manufactured using the company's 6nm process node, which is also likely to be the company's flagship processor for 2021.
The lower process number represents higher chip density and better performance and energy efficiency.
The upcoming flagship chip is expected to feature Mali G-77 GPU and high-performance ARM Cortex-A78 core.
Several leaks and rumours about the chip suggest a benchmark score equivalent to Qualcomm’s last year flagship Snapdragon 865+.
The Snapdragon 865+ was based on the TSMC’s 7nm processor, while its successor Snapdragon 888 is based on a 5nm process. Also, Samsung Exynos 2100 will also be based on the same 5nm process.
Also, the upcoming MediaTek processor is expected to arrive in the budget to mid-range smartphones.
